The Product

What myDW Does — In Plain Terms

myDW is a cloud-based health monitoring and management platform for DW surveillance systems. Your customer gets a single dashboard that watches their cameras and recorders 24/7 and alerts them when something needs attention — without anyone having to physically check.

🗺️
Auto-Plot Site Map
The dashboard opens to the Map tab by default. Registered recorders auto-plot to a map by the location entered during setup — instant visual overview of every site without manual configuration.
📡
Camera Health Monitoring
Connectivity loss, recording status, HDD health, image quality — all monitored continuously. Alerts fire when something breaks before the customer notices.
🔔
Proactive Alerts
Customers get notified of issues in real time — not three weeks later when they're trying to pull footage for an incident.
🎥
Secure Video Sharing
Share encrypted video clips via cloud link with management, HR, or law enforcement. No USB drives. No email attachments. No risk of virus or tampering.
👥
Multi-Site Management
One dashboard for all their locations. Especially valuable for customers with multiple sites who currently have no visibility across the whole system.
🔒
Multi-Factor Authentication
2FA and encrypted communications baked in. Speaks directly to customers in regulated industries or anyone who's dealt with a cybersecurity audit.
💻
No Software to Install
Browser-based. Works on any device, any OS. No IT involvement required for the customer. No plugins, no downloads, no support calls from them about installation.
Pricing

The Numbers — What It Costs Your Customer

myDW is priced at $3.00 per camera, per month (MSRP). Subscriptions are available in 12-month or 36-month terms. Channel counts are fully flexible — mix and match key sizes to fit the exact camera count at any site.

By Site Size — Annual Cost to Customer

Small Site
16
cameras
Per month$48
12-month$576
36-month$1,728
e.g. 1× 16-channel key

Flexible Channel Bundling

Keys can be combined in any configuration to match the exact camera count at a site. You're never paying for channels you don't use, and you're never forced into the nearest tier above your actual count.

48-ch + 16-ch + 1-ch + 1-ch + 1-ch = 67 cameras exact — no waste
16-ch + 16-ch + 8-ch = 40 cameras retail, warehouse, school
48-ch + 48-ch + 24-ch = 120 cameras large commercial / multi-building
For Pricing on Keys Contact your DW sales rep for distributor pricing on subscription keys. MSRP shown here is end-customer pricing. Your margin is your own to set within your distribution agreement.

Objection Handling

Common Pushback — And How to Answer It

We already have someone checking the cameras.
Manual checks tell you what's working right now. myDW tells you when something stopped working at 2am last Tuesday. Those are different things — and one of them happens between checks.
$3 per camera per month sounds like it adds up.
On a 16-camera system it's $48 a month. One call to your security company when you can't find footage after an incident probably costs more than that in time alone — and that's before anything actually happens. The 36-month subscription also works out better per month if they're committed to the long term.
We've never needed this before.
Most customers say that right up until they do. It's the same reason you have a fire suppression system — not because you expect a fire, but because you can't afford to find out without one. This is the same idea for your surveillance investment.
Is this something our IT department needs to set up?
No. It's completely browser-based — nothing to install, no network configuration changes, no IT involvement required. If they can open a browser, they're set up.
Can we try it before committing?
Yes. Ask me to request a demo key from our sales team — we can walk you through the platform on a live system so you can see exactly what it looks like before any money changes hands.
Best-Fit Targets

Who to Talk to First in Your Existing Base

Not every customer is the right first conversation. These are the profiles where myDW lands most naturally — prioritize these when you're getting started.

🏪
Multi-Location Retail
High camera counts, no dedicated IT, managers who can't physically check every location. The multi-site dashboard is the immediate value.
🏢
Property Management
Multiple buildings, minimal on-site security staff, compliance requirements. Remote health monitoring reduces physical visits.
🏫
Schools & Government
NDAA/TAA compliance, video evidence requirements, limited IT resources. SOC 2 attestation and 2FA speak directly to their procurement checklist.
🏭
Warehouses & Distribution
High camera counts, large facilities, 24/7 operations where downtime is costly. HDD and recording health alerts are especially valuable.
